POST clients/ProcessTempSuspendClient

Request Information

URI Parameters

None.

Body Parameters

ClientStatusEdit
NameDescriptionTypeAdditional information
CustId

integer

None.

CustCode

string

None.

CancellationDocumentation

date

None.

SuspendServiceOn

date

None.

ReactivateServiceOn

date

None.

ContractLastBillingMonth

date

None.

SuspendSMS

boolean

None.

SMSTemplate

integer

None.

DebtorSMSSend

boolean

None.

ClientSMSSend

boolean

None.

SuspensionType

string

None.

MainReason

integer

None.

SubReason

integer

None.

Opposion

string

None.

SuspendNotes

string

None.

LsnCustId

integer

None.

ImmediateSuspension

boolean

None.

SuspendAll

boolean

None.

ClientMovementSubTypeId

integer

None.

ClientMovementSubTypeDetailId

integer

None.

ActivateEmailId

integer

None.

SendActivateEmail

boolean

None.

Request Formats

application/json, text/json

Sample:
{
  "CustId": 1,
  "CustCode": "sample string 2",
  "CancellationDocumentation": "2026-04-17T11:32:30.827824+00:00",
  "SuspendServiceOn": "2026-04-17T11:32:30.827824+00:00",
  "ReactivateServiceOn": "2026-04-17T11:32:30.827824+00:00",
  "ContractLastBillingMonth": "2026-04-17T11:32:30.827824+00:00",
  "SuspendSMS": true,
  "SMSTemplate": 1,
  "DebtorSMSSend": true,
  "ClientSMSSend": true,
  "SuspensionType": "sample string 5",
  "MainReason": 6,
  "SubReason": 7,
  "Opposion": "sample string 8",
  "SuspendNotes": "sample string 9",
  "LsnCustId": 1,
  "ImmediateSuspension": true,
  "SuspendAll": true,
  "ClientMovementSubTypeId": 12,
  "ClientMovementSubTypeDetailId": 13,
  "ActivateEmailId": 1,
  "SendActivateEmail": true
}

text/html

Sample:
{"CustId":1,"CustCode":"sample string 2","CancellationDocumentation":"2026-04-17T11:32:30.827824+00:00","SuspendServiceOn":"2026-04-17T11:32:30.827824+00:00","ReactivateServiceOn":"2026-04-17T11:32:30.827824+00:00","ContractLastBillingMonth":"2026-04-17T11:32:30.827824+00:00","SuspendSMS":true,"SMSTemplate":1,"DebtorSMSSend":true,"ClientSMSSend":true,"SuspensionType":"sample string 5","MainReason":6,"SubReason":7,"Opposion":"sample string 8","SuspendNotes":"sample string 9","LsnCustId":1,"ImmediateSuspension":true,"SuspendAll":true,"ClientMovementSubTypeId":12,"ClientMovementSubTypeDetailId":13,"ActivateEmailId":1,"SendActivateEmail":true}

application/xml, text/xml

Sample:
<ClientStatusEdit xmlns:i="http://www.w3.org/2001/XMLSchema-instance" xmlns="http://schemas.datacontract.org/2004/07/ListenerOnline.BusinessEntities.Clients">
  <ActivateEmailId>1</ActivateEmailId>
  <CancellationDocumentation>2026-04-17T11:32:30.827824+00:00</CancellationDocumentation>
  <ClientMovementSubTypeDetailId>13</ClientMovementSubTypeDetailId>
  <ClientMovementSubTypeId>12</ClientMovementSubTypeId>
  <ClientSMSSend>true</ClientSMSSend>
  <ContractLastBillingMonth>2026-04-17T11:32:30.827824+00:00</ContractLastBillingMonth>
  <CustCode>sample string 2</CustCode>
  <CustId>1</CustId>
  <DebtorSMSSend>true</DebtorSMSSend>
  <ImmediateSuspension>true</ImmediateSuspension>
  <LsnCustId>1</LsnCustId>
  <MainReason>6</MainReason>
  <Opposion>sample string 8</Opposion>
  <ReactivateServiceOn>2026-04-17T11:32:30.827824+00:00</ReactivateServiceOn>
  <SMSTemplate>1</SMSTemplate>
  <SendActivateEmail>true</SendActivateEmail>
  <SubReason>7</SubReason>
  <SuspendAll>true</SuspendAll>
  <SuspendNotes>sample string 9</SuspendNotes>
  <SuspendSMS>true</SuspendSMS>
  <SuspendServiceOn>2026-04-17T11:32:30.827824+00:00</SuspendServiceOn>
  <SuspensionType>sample string 5</SuspensionType>
</ClientStatusEdit>

application/x-www-form-urlencoded

Sample:

Failed to generate the sample for media type 'application/x-www-form-urlencoded'. Cannot use formatter 'JQueryMvcFormUrlEncodedFormatter' to write type 'ClientStatusEdit'.

Response Information

Resource Description

IHttpActionResult

None.

Response Formats

application/json, text/json, text/html, application/xml, text/xml

Sample:

Sample not available.